Carl Rodgers describe an individual that has reached his/her full potential by living a life defined by unconditional love, genuineness, openness and empathy as a <u>Fully Functioning Person.</u>

Carl Rogers came up with five things that a fully functioning person has:

1. Be willing to try new things and accept both good and bad feelings. Negative feelings are not ignored; instead, they are dealt with.

2.Existential living means being in touch with different experiences as they happen in life and not judging or making assumptions about them ahead of time. Being able to live in the present and enjoy it fully, instead of always thinking about the past or the future.

3. Trust your feelings: You pay attention to and trust your feelings, instincts, and gut reactions. The right decisions are the ones that people make for themselves, and we should trust ourselves to make the right ones.

4. Creativity: Thinking creatively and taking risks are important parts of a person's life. People don't always play it safe. This means being able to adapt, change, and look for new experiences.

5. A fulfilled life is one in which a person is happy and content with their life, and they are always looking for new things to do and learn.

The purpose of the 15th Amendment was to ensure that states or communities were not denying men the right to vote simply based on their race. The right to vote is known as suffrage. The 15th Amendment, which was ratified in 1870, contained two sections.
